Subject: Key rotation — Streamlace compression gateway

Hi plugin folks,

We're rotating keys for the internal frame-stats service tonight. Quick context: we flipped permessage-deflate off for small payloads after CPU spikes on the Corvid tier — compression only pays off above ~2 KB frames, so your plugins should batch accordingly. Old keys die Friday. The new one for staging is pasted below.

API key for yahig-tadup: kto7_ubizbYm

**Q: A customer's export failed — can they just retry it?**

Yep, mostly. Failed exports in Quillbox can be retried up to three times from the Exports tab; after that the job gets locked and needs a manual reset from our side. Check the failure reason first — quota errors won't fix themselves. The full retry procedure lives on the internal page below.

runbook for badug-kadup: https://confluence.zemvarlabs.internal/projects/browse/display/projects/bd1b

Checklist item 5 — Off-site run: returned demo units

Shift lead: the nine Pexaline demo units coming back from the Rillford showroom land on tomorrow's run. Count them against the returns sheet, flag any with cracked casings, and stage them in bay C — don't shelve them yet, QA wants a look first. For the courier hand-over, follow the confidential instruction given just below.

dispatch memo: the eliath belael courier leaves the praox ledger at gate 8841 under passcode 017589

## Service Accounts — Ormskirk Migration

The legacy ORM layer in Tallowby is being refactored to the new Quillbase data access kit. During migration, both paths run side by side under the svc-ormskirk account. Support: if customers report stale records, check the shadow-write queue first. Do not grant this account extra scopes; it only needs read/write on the migration schema. Its current key appears below.

app token of bahaf-tajeg = zpat23_SjjsllwiLmXbtS65veZaV47